## Formula sandbox tuning

User-supplied formulas in Gridmoor execute inside a restricted interpreter with hard ceilings on time, memory, and call depth. Reviewers should confirm any change to these ceilings is justified in the PR description, since raising them widens the abuse surface. Defaults were chosen from production traces. The current limits are as follows.

limits module of tafog-fawip:
WEIGHTS = {
    "julix": 57,
    "lamys": 992,
    "kasvan": 209,
    "quenok": 750,
    "alddor": 259,
    "oliath": 1009,
    "wenix": 815,
}

14:22 — Fan-out queue on Pipsqueak Notify hit backpressure limits again; consumers were draining slower than the burst from the Harwell tenant's digest job. We throttled producers and things recovered by 14:31, but keep an eye on queue depth overnight. For correlation, the relevant trace token is right below this entry.

session token of kageg-tahop = htk14_af3c1ccccb7dcf

For the weekly eng sync: we identified configuration drift between the Meridly sync workers in the Holtsford and Braywick regions. Holtsford workers were updated to the new conflict-resolution policy (last-writer-wins with tombstone checks), while Braywick still runs the legacy merge behavior. The result is duplicate and ghost events for tenants whose calendars replicate across both regions. Remediation is to re-pin Braywick to the shared baseline and redeploy. The baseline configuration that both regions should converge on is shown below.

settings of yadup-tajef:
[pelys]
team = raleth
access_code = ac_67f5a1
host = pelys.olvarqlabs.local
port = 8080
owner = pramir.pramir
peer = rusir.qirvanio.corp